In the ever-evolving landscape of the food processing industry, the demand for health-conscious snacks like protein bars has increased significantly. As a result, manufacturers are seeking efficient solutions to meet this growing demand. This is where the automatic protein bar machine comes into play, providing an innovative approach to producing these nutritious snacks with remarkable precision and speed.
An automatic protein bar machine is designed to streamline the production process of protein bars, ensuring consistent quality and adherence to specific formulations. By automating key processes such as mixing, forming, cutting, and packaging, these machines minimize human error and enhance operational efficiency. This level of automation is crucial in today's fast-paced food market, where speed and accuracy are paramount.
One of the primary advantages of using an automatic protein bar machine is its ability to handle a variety of ingredients, including various types of proteins, sweeteners, and flavorings. This flexibility allows manufacturers to cater to different dietary preferences and market trends, such as vegan, gluten-free, or low-sugar options. Furthermore, the machine's programmable settings enable manufacturers to adjust recipes easily, facilitating product innovation and diversity.
Another benefit is the consistent texture and quality of the protein bars produced. Unlike manual methods, which can lead to inconsistencies due to varying human input, an automatic machine ensures each bar maintains uniformity in size, weight, and density. This consistency not only helps in meeting regulatory standards but also enhances consumer satisfaction by providing a product that is visually appealing and reliable in taste.
Moreover, the efficiency of an automatic protein bar machine can lead to significant cost savings over time. With reduced labor costs, minimized waste, and faster production speeds, manufacturers can increase their output without compromising quality. This is particularly important in competitive markets, where profit margins can be tight, and every second counts during production.
